The doula who led my birthing class at Realbirth said that it was a good idea to have a birthing plan. She said you could even include small things in it such as: you want the door closed during delivery; you want a mirror in the room; you want to use the birthing bar; and you do not want residents in your room if you are at a teaching hospital like NYU. Obviously there are many other things to include these are just some things I remember the doula speaking about.

Dr. say you can have one, but its not a contract. Meaning, for ex., you can say you don't want a certain thing, but, if the dr. feels its needed for your or the baby the dr. has the right and obligation to do it, even though its 'against' your birth plan.

You can also say things like you want the baby to be in your arms after delivery, or you don't want them to be wisked away right away, and all those things. But again, if the drs. or nurse needs to do it, they will do it anyway.


I do think however, that its important to tell your dr. your wishes, and hopefully the dr. will honor those wishes to the best of his/hers ability.
